سرعت سایت به یکی از عوامل کلیدی موفقیت آنلاین تبدیل شده است. کاربران انتظار دارند وبسایتها به سرعت بارگذاری شوند و تجربه کاربری سریعی داشته باشند. در این مقاله، به بررسی نقش لیزی لودینگ (Lazy Loading) در بهبود سرعت سایت خواهیم پرداخت. خواهیم دید که چگونه این تکنیک میتواند به کاهش زمان بارگذاری صفحات کمک کند و تجربه کاربری را بهبود بخشد.
چه چیزی باعث کندی سایت میشود؟
قبل از اینکه به لیزی لودینگ بپردازیم، بهتر است بدانیم چه چیزی باعث کندی سایت میشود. برخی از عوامل اصلی که باعث کند شدن سایت میشوند عبارتند از:
- حجم زیاد تصاویر: تصاویر با کیفیت بالا و حجم زیاد میتوانند زمان بارگذاری صفحات را افزایش دهند.
- تعداد زیاد درخواستهای HTTP: هر بار که مرورگر برای دریافت یک فایل (تصویر، اسکریپت، استایلشیت) درخواست میدهد، یک درخواست HTTP ارسال میشود. تعداد زیاد این درخواستها میتواند باعث کندی سایت شود.
- عدم استفاده از کش: کش میتواند فایلهای استاتیک سایت را ذخیره کند و در درخواستهای بعدی از آن استفاده کند. این باعث کاهش بار سرور و افزایش سرعت سایت میشود.
- کدهای جاوا اسکریپت سنگین: کدهای جاوا اسکریپت پیچیده و سنگین میتوانند زمان اجرای صفحه را افزایش دهند.
لیزی لودینگ چیست؟
لیزی لودینگ تکنیکی است که در آن تصاویر و سایر عناصر صفحه تنها زمانی بارگذاری میشوند که کاربر به آنها نزدیک میشود. این تکنیک باعث میشود که مرورگر تنها عناصر مورد نیاز را بارگذاری کند و از بارگذاری همزمان تمام عناصر صفحه جلوگیری میکند.
مزایای لیزی لودینگ
لیزی لودینگ مزایای زیادی دارد، از جمله:
- کاهش زمان بارگذاری صفحات: با بارگذاری تنها عناصر مورد نیاز، لیزی لودینگ میتواند زمان بارگذاری صفحات را به طور قابل توجهی کاهش دهد.
- بهبود تجربه کاربری: کاربران سریعتر به محتوای مورد نظر خود دسترسی پیدا میکنند و تجربه کاربری بهتری خواهند داشت.
- کاهش مصرف پهنای باند: با بارگذاری تنها عناصر مورد نیاز، لیزی لودینگ میتواند مصرف پهنای باند را کاهش دهد.
- افزایش رتبه در موتورهای جستجو: گوگل و سایر موتورهای جستجو به سرعت سایت اهمیت میدهند. با بهبود سرعت سایت، میتوانید رتبه خود را در نتایج جستجو بهبود بخشید.
چگونه لیزی لودینگ را پیادهسازی کنیم؟
پیادهسازی لیزی لودینگ به چند روش مختلف امکانپذیر است:
- استفاده از کتابخانههای جاوا اسکریپت: کتابخانههایی مانند LazyLoad و Intersection Observer API میتوانند به شما در پیادهسازی لیزی لودینگ کمک کنند.
- استفاده از ویژگیهای جدید HTML: برخی از ویژگیهای جدید HTML مانند
loading="lazy"
میتوانند برای بارگذاری تنبل تصاویر استفاده شوند.
نکات مهم در استفاده از لیزی لودینگ
- مراقب باشید که لیزی لودینگ باعث نشود که محتوا به درستی نمایش داده نشود.
- از لیزی لودینگ برای عناصر مهمی مانند لوگو و نوار ناوبری استفاده نکنید.
- تست کنید، تست کنید، تست کنید! قبل از اینکه لیزی لودینگ را در سایت خود پیادهسازی کنید، آن را به خوبی تست کنید تا مطمئن شوید که به درستی کار میکند.
نتیجهگیری
لیزی لودینگ یک تکنیک قدرتمند برای بهبود سرعت سایت است. با پیادهسازی صحیح این تکنیک، میتوانید تجربه کاربری را بهبود بخشید، رتبه خود را در موتورهای جستجو افزایش دهید و در نهایت، کسب و کار آنلاین خود را رونق دهید.
سوالات متداول
1. آیا لیزی لودینگ برای همه سایتها مناسب است؟
بله، لیزی لودینگ برای اکثر سایتها مناسب است. با این حال، برای سایتهای کوچک و ساده ممکن است تفاوت چندانی ایجاد نکند.
2. آیا لیزی لودینگ میتواند بر سئو سایت تأثیر بگذارد؟
بله، لیزی لودینگ میتواند بر سئو سایت تأثیر مثبت بگذارد. گوگل به سرعت سایت اهمیت میدهد و با بهبود سرعت سایت، میتوانید رتبه خود را در نتایج جستجو بهبود بخشید.
3. آیا لیزی لودینگ میتواند بر تجربه کاربری موبایل تأثیر بگذارد؟
بله، لیزی لودینگ میتواند بر تجربه کاربری موبایل تأثیر مثبت بگذارد. با کاهش زمان بارگذاری صفحات، کاربران موبایل تجربه کاربری بهتری خواهند داشت.
4. آیا لیزی لودینگ میتواند بر امنیت سایت تأثیر بگذارد؟
خیر، لیزی لودینگ تأثیری بر امنیت سایت ندارد.
5. چگونه میتوانم بفهمم که لیزی لودینگ در سایتم به درستی کار میکند؟
میتوانید از ابزارهای مختلفی برای بررسی عملکرد سایت خود استفاده کنید. همچنین میتوانید از مرورگر خود برای بررسی شبکه استفاده کنید و ببینید که چه فایلهایی بارگذاری میشوند.
سخن پایانی
امیدوارم این مقاله به شما کمک کرده باشد تا درک بهتری از لیزی لودینگ و مزایای آن داشته باشید. با پیادهسازی صحیح این تکنیک، میتوانید سرعت سایت خود را بهبود بخشید و تجربه کاربری را برای بازدیدکنندگان خود بهینه کنید.
به دو روش می توانید با تیم هانت به یک متخصص سئو تبدیل شوید:
دیدگاهتان را بنویسید